In today's modern worlds of communication, the art of letter writing is a long-lost practice. It requires patience, but also evokes anticipation and hope.
This multi-generational love story belongs to Carly and Adam from British Columbia. But also Irene and Nick, Carly's grandparents. Irene was a British war bride and Nick was her Canadian soldier husband.
When Carly discovered her grandmother's love letters, it inspired her to cross the sea for an adventure and pick up the pen herself. 67 years after the original letters were written, Carly and Adam started writing their own love letters.
This is an epic tale of retracing family history and writing a whole new chapter of romance, which happened to lead to a surprise wedding.
